Which general election did Neville Chamberlain first become a Member of Parliament?
1910
1914
1916
1918
Answer
Neville Chamberlain first became a Member of Parliament in the 1918 general election. He was elected to represent the new Birmingham Ladywood division at the age of 49, following in the footsteps of his father and elder half-brother.
